| # | Time | Username | Problem | Language | Result | Execution time | Memory |
|---|---|---|---|---|---|---|---|
| 1355236 | kasamchi | Voltage 2 (JOI26_voltage) | C++20 | 28 ms | 680 KiB |
#include "voltage.h"
#include <bits/stdc++.h>
using namespace std;
bool solve(int N, int M) {
vector<int> ans;
vector<bool> vis(N);
while (ans.size() < N) {
vector<int> cur;
for (int i = 0; i < N; i++) {
if (!vis[i]) {
vector<int> x(N), y(N);
y[i] = 1;
for (int j : ans) {
y[j] = 1;
}
if (query(x, y) == 0) {
cur.push_back(i);
vis[i] = true;
}
}
}
if (cur.empty()) {
return false;
}
for (int x : cur) {
ans.push_back(x);
}
}
for (int i = 0; i + 1 < N; i++) {
answer(ans[i + 1], ans[i]);
}
return true;
}
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
| # | Verdict | Execution time | Memory | Grader output |
|---|---|---|---|---|
| Fetching results... | ||||
